Rooms
All bedrooms at Merlewood Hotel are ensuite and equipped with flat screen TVs, hairdryers, and tea/coffee facilities. A range of configurations, including Single, Double, Twin, and Family Rooms, are available for diverse accommodation needs. Some rooms offer limited Sea Views or delightful views over the village of Saundersfoot.
Location
Merlewood Hotel is set just a 10-minute walk from the serene beach and harbor, providing opportunities for safe swimming, fishing, and boat trips. The Pembrokeshire Coast National Park coast path is accessible within a 5-minute walk, offering stunning hiking trails. Local attractions, such as theme parks, are located within 15 miles from the hotel.
Dining
The hotel provides a spacious Bar Lounge that overlooks the bay, creating a pleasant spot to relax. Guests can enjoy a range of dining options, including bar meals and restaurant services. Outdoor dining options are available during the summer season by the pool.
Family-Friendly Accommodations
Family Rooms accommodate 3 to 4 guests, ideal for parents traveling with children. Rooms are furnished with a double bed and single bed or bunk beds, offering versatile sleeping arrangements. Some ground floor rooms provide wet room en-suites suitable for lesser able guests.
Outdoor Amenities
An outdoor swimming pool is open from Whitsun to the 1st of September, inviting guests to enjoy a refreshing swim during their stay. The expansive grounds allow for leisurely walks and activities close to nature. This accessibility complements various nearby outdoor attractions.

Saundersfoot Harbour
7 minutes' walk
Picturesque harbor with stunning views, perfect for a leisurely stroll or watching fishing boats. Ideal for photography lovers.
Folly Farm
8 minutes' drive
Award-winning family attraction featuring a zoo, vintage funfair, and play areas. Great for families seeking a fun day out.
Monkstone Beach
25 minutes' walk
Beautiful beach known for rock pools and tide pools. Perfect for family picnics or a relaxing day by the sea.
Silent World Aquarium
6 minutes' drive
Unique aquarium with marine wildlife exhibits and interactive displays. Great for family outings and learning experiences.
Kayaking at Saundersfoot Beach
7 minutes' walk
Thrilling kayaking experiences available for all skill levels. Rentals and lessons offered right on the beach.
Yoga by the Sea
7 minutes' walk
Relaxing outdoor yoga classes offered at Saundersfoot Beach. Booking required; ideal for unwinding and reconnecting.
The Argosy Fish & Chip Shop
6 minutes' walk
Traditional British fish and chips in a casual setting. Local favorite known for fresh, quality seafood; takeout available.
Pizzabellas
6 minutes' walk
Charming pizzeria offering artisan pizzas and local ingredients. Ideal for families or casual dining; vegetarian options available.
De Valence Pavilion
10 minutes' drive
Historic venue with live music and events. Hosts regular performances, including comedy and concerts, suitable for all ages.
Saundersfoot Sports and Social Club
6 minutes' walk
Friendly local social club with darts, pool, and occasional live entertainment. Good atmosphere for mingling with locals.
